Figure 2-17.

Chronic hemorrhage with hemosiderin. Tissue aspirate. Dog.
Several foamy macrophages are present in this follicular cyst lesion. The macrophage directly below the cholesterol crystal contains blue-green granular material the cytoplasm consistent with hemosiderin, a breakdown product of erythrocytes. On the left edge is a macrophage with large black granules suggestive of hemosiderin. (Wright; HP oil.)
